Hi all, I'm new to RootsChat but I have been researching my Warwick branch of the tree for several years now. I'm excited to find others here who share the same ancestors as me. Abraham Warwick b1811 Furneaux Pelham and Sarah Wallis b1810 Buntingford.
I descend from their son, John who moved to London grew his family there, one of whom was my great great grandfather (also John) who married Elizabeth Sparshott and lived with her and their many children in Battersea.
